The Couch Critic Logo
The Couch CriticCouch Critic
TrendingMoviesTV ShowsListsReviewsWhat to Watch
LogoThe Couch Critic

Menu

TrendingMoviesTV ShowsListsReviewsWhat to Watch

© 2026 The Couch Critic

The Couch Critic Logo

The Couch Critic

Your go-to destination for honest movie and TV show reviews from a passionate community of critics. Join the conversation today.

X

Explore

  • Trending
  • Movies
  • TV Shows
  • Reviews
  • Lists
  • Games
  • About Us

Categories

  • Popular Movies
  • Trending Now
  • Upcoming
  • Airing Today
  • Movie Genres
  • TV Genres

Community

  • Guides
  • What to Watch

Legal

  • Privacy Policy
  • Terms of Service
  • Cookie Policy
  • RSS Feed
© 2026 The Couch Critic.•Built by Hayden Thorn
Cookie Settings
The Movie Database

This application uses TMDB and the TMDB APIs but is not endorsed, certified, or otherwise approved by TMDB.

Home/People/James Mcahren
James Mcahren profile photo
Born
Mar 19, 1984
Age 41
Place of Birth
Dartford, Kent, England
Known For
Acting
Gender
Male

Career Highlights

56
Movies
6
TV Shows
Also Known As
Jimmy Havoc
Dai Konran
El Transexico

James Mcahren

Acting

Biography
Jim Mcahren is a British professional wrestler better known by the ring name Jimmy Havoc. He is known for his work through the British and European independent promotions. Havoc is currently regularly working for International Pro Wrestling: United Kingdom, Insane Championship Wrestling, and is currently on a hiatus from PROGRESS Wrestling and is the former and longest reigning Progress Wrestling champion Independent circuit (2004–present) Jimmy Havoc trained at NWA UK Hammerlock under Andre Baker and Jon Ryan, alongside the likes of Zack Sabre Jr and Fergal Devitt before making his debut in 2004. Wrestling exclusively under the Hammerlock banner until 2006, he made his first appearances outside of the promotion for Triple X Wrestling where he first started appearing as a "deathmatch" or hardcore wrestler. He quickly became known as one of the top deathmatch wrestlers in Europe, debuting for International Pro Wrestling: United Kingdom in 2008, Germany's Westside Xtreme Wrestling in 2009 and appearing on a joint show between WXW and U.S. hardcore promotionCombat Zone Wrestling in 2010. Havoc appeared in European versions of the CZW Tournament of Death in both 2010 and 2012. As of 2013 has made appearances in other independent companies such as Mid-Atlantic Wrestling and Full Impact Pro.
GCW Emo Fight poster

GCW Emo Fight

as Jimmy Havoc
2021
MLW Saturday Night SuperFight poster

MLW Saturday Night SuperFight

as Jimmy Havoc
2019
All Elite Wrestling All Out 2019 poster

All Elite Wrestling All Out 2019

Cast
2019
AEW All Out 2019 poster

AEW All Out 2019

as Jimmy Havoc
2019
All Elite Wrestling Fight for the Fallen 2019 poster

All Elite Wrestling Fight for the Fallen 2019

Cast
2019
AEW Fight for the Fallen poster

AEW Fight for the Fallen

as Jimmy Havoc
2019
AEW Fyter Fest poster

AEW Fyter Fest

as Jimmy Havoc
2019
AEW Double or Nothing 2019: The Buy In poster

AEW Double or Nothing 2019: The Buy In

as Jimmy Havoc
2019
PROGRESS Chapter 88: Super Strong Style 16 - Day 3 poster

PROGRESS Chapter 88: Super Strong Style 16 - Day 3

as Jimmy Havoc
2019
PROGRESS Chapter 88: Super Strong Style 16 - Day 2 poster

PROGRESS Chapter 88: Super Strong Style 16 - Day 2

as Jimmy Havoc
2019
PROGRESS Chapter 86: Corrupted Harmony poster

PROGRESS Chapter 86: Corrupted Harmony

as Jimmy Havoc
2019
PROGRESS Chapter 85: Progro.Naut poster

PROGRESS Chapter 85: Progro.Naut

as Jimmy Havoc
2019
Making Enemies: Ospreay & Havoc poster

Making Enemies: Ospreay & Havoc

as Jimmy Havoc
2019
ICW Fear and Loathing XI poster

ICW Fear and Loathing XI

as Jimmy Havoc
2018
PROGRESS Chapter 79: One Big Neck With Sausage Hands poster

PROGRESS Chapter 79: One Big Neck With Sausage Hands

as Jimmy Havoc
2018
RIPTIDE: Black Water 2018 poster

RIPTIDE: Black Water 2018

as Jimmy Havoc
2018
PROGRESS Chapter 77: Pumpkin Spice PROGRESS poster

PROGRESS Chapter 77: Pumpkin Spice PROGRESS

as Jimmy Havoc
2018
PROGRESS Chapter 76: Hello Wembley poster

PROGRESS Chapter 76: Hello Wembley

as Jimmy Havoc
2018
MLW War Games 2018 poster

MLW War Games 2018

as Jimmy Havoc
2018
PROGRESS Chapter 75: These Violent Delights Have Violent Ends poster

PROGRESS Chapter 75: These Violent Delights Have Violent Ends

as Jimmy Havoc
2018